One killed, three hurt in Claiborne head-on crash

A head-on crash on State Route 63 in Claiborne County Sunday afternoon resulted in one person being killed and three others injured.
According to a preliminary report from the Tennessee Highway Patrol, at 4:45 p.m., Sunday, a 2010 Toyota Camry driven by Justin C. Webb, 34, was traveling westbound on State Route 63 at Ausmus Lane when it collided with a 2002 Honda Accord, driven by Taylor McNew, 30.
Stacey Vinsant, 44, was a passenger in Webb’s car and was killed in the crash. Vinsant was wearing a seat belt.
Webb’s car failed to maintain its lane of travel, crossing the center line, and striking the Honda head-on causing disabling damage to both motor vehicles. After the impact, the Toyota went off the roadway to the left side onto a grassy shoulder before coming to a final uncontrolled rest.
The Honda came to a final uncontrolled rest in the middle of the roadway after being struck. Crash scene evidence showed that the Toyota was driving left of center at the time of impact.
Webb and McNew, along with Jonathan Ausmus, 38, a passenger in McNew’s vehicle, were all injured and taken to area hospitals for treatment. All three were wearing their seat belts.
The investigation is ongoing and charges are pending.
